European Communities (Hygiene of Foodstuffs) Regulations, 2000 (S.I. No. 165 of 2000).

These Regulations give effect to Council Directive 93/43/EEC on the hygiene of foodstuffs. They cover all stages after primary production and set down the obligations on proprietors of food businesses, including the requirement that such business is operated in a hygienic way. The rules of hygiene cover requirements for premises, rooms where food is prepared, foodstuffs, transportation, equipment, food waste, water supply, personal hygiene and training.
